**Molecular Mechanism and Rationale** The mannose-6-phosphate receptor (M6PR), encoded by the IGF2R gene, serves as the critical trafficking hub for lysosomal enzyme delivery from the trans-Golgi network to lysosomes. This 300-kDa type I transmembrane glycoprotein recognizes mannose-6-phosphate (M6P) modifications on newly synthesized acid hydrolases, facilitating their transport via clathrin-coated vesicles to late endosomes and ultimately to lysosomes. **SASP-Mediated Complement Cascade Amplification in Alzheimer's Disease** **Overview: Senescence, Inflammation, and Synaptic Loss** Cellular senescence—a state of irreversible growth arrest accompanied by a pro-inflammatory secretome—accumulates dramatically with age and in Alzheimer's disease.
